- May 9 - June 15, 2008: "Artomatic", Washington, D.C.
- July 28 - Sept. 23, 2008: "Reincarnations", the Gallery Space, Washington, D.C.
- 2009: "Food Glorious Food IV: Changing Courses", Zenith Gallery, Washington, D.C. A calendar including John Pack's work was produced for the show and sold to benefit the Capital Area Food Bank.
- Apr. 2010: Interview with Explore, a multi-media division of the Annenberg Foundation, for a documentary film on "The Art and Science of Seashells," Sanibel, FL.
- June - Aug. 2010: "59th Annual All Florida Juried Competition and Exhibition", Boca Raton Museum of Art, Boca Raton, FL.
- Nov. - Dec. 2010 issue: "Hall of Fame" list, Florida International Magazine. Recognized in the article "Florida Artists: A Showcase, An Album of Established and Emerging Artists Pushing Creativity Forward."
- Nov. 13, 2010: Florida International Magazine November Launch Party - Artist Showcase, Miami, FL.
- Nov. 13, 2010: Soho Arts Pavilion exhibition hosted by Andrew Rothchild and Ilana Vardy, Miami, FL.
